Servo hydraulic actuators are generally position controlled, and the position feedback must be calibrated by trained technicians using specialized equipment. When servo hydraulic actuators are replaced for any reason, it is important that the calibration of the internal position feedback of the replacement actuator is close to the original. In addition, conventional methods only permit static calibration of the position feedback. The object of this paper is to show a practical method for checking the position calibration using accelerometers as sensors.
